    Three different methods used:
    HDMI + USB power
    1) @6:49 (Firestick)
    a) Tyler HD television
    b) Firestick
    c) Cellphone with hotspot
    AV-Inputs only
    2) @10:20 (Roku)
    a) Casio Portable TV-900
    b) Roku
    c) HDMI to AV adapter
    d) 3.5mm plug to RCA cable
    e) gender changers
    f) Power brick
    g) Cellphone with hotspot
    Antenna Only
    3) @14:56 (Chromecast)
    a) Casio Portable TV-970
    b) Google Chromecast
    c) Coax to plug into the TV
    d) 3.5mm to Coax adapter
    e) UPGrow HDMI to AV converter
    f) AV wire
    g) RF Modulator
    h) Three output Power brick
    i) USB to 12V DC to DC Converter
    j) Cellphone with hotspot

    Thank you! Quick question please, the second small TV you used with the Roku you used a 3.5mm to coax adapter. If I plugged in an external flat antenna like a mohu, and then scanned the tv for channels would it pick up the over the air channels?

    • @WaybackRewind
      @WaybackRewind  Před 8 měsíci

      Well no, unfortunately you cannot plug an antenna directly into the second small TV, (or the third one either), and scan for channels because it cannot understand digital channels. I have a different video that shows how to connect an antenna to any TV but it requires a converter to make it work. czcams.com/video/FSb67v6yU8A/video.html
      It's not difficult, but different.

    I went out bought all the stuff i need. It goes fuzzy. Was white screen at one point. Old tv like last one. Rf modulator only has channel 3 and 4. That problem?

    • @WaybackRewind
      @WaybackRewind  Před 10 měsíci +1

      Channel 3 and 4 only should not be a problem ordinarily. What I have found is that old tvs being analog the tuner may have driven outside the range that it's designed to tune in. Set it to channel 4 and then try 2 or 3 or maybe 5 or 6. You might get lucky. If not maybe the TV just not longer works at all. I wasn't sure my TV still worked.
